Ensuring your Ocala property is safe involves a detailed electrical inspection. This overview outlines the key items a licensed electrician will verify during a home electrical inspection. They'll check the main service panel, assessing proper labeling and amperage. Wiring throughout the dwelling will be closely reviewed, with a focus on state and adherence to building regulations. Outlets, toggle switches, and lamps will be verified for functionality and safe grounding. The inspector will also note any signs of damage like loose connections. Finally, they'll assess the earthing system and fire alarms to ensure optimal safety.

Ocala Electrical Inspection for Home Sellers: What to Expect

Selling the residence in Ocala? You’ll likely facing an electrical inspection as a requirement for the closing process. The what sellers should generally expect. A qualified professional will meticulously check the electrical setup, covering the service panel , wiring , plugs, and smoke detectors . They’ll be identifying potential hazards like damaged insulation . Small defects often require a quick fix , while serious issues could demand further investigation and might affect the sale price . Anticipate a assessment outlining the inspection results and necessary actions .

Essential Electrical Checklist for Ocala Home Owners

Preparing your local property for sale? Don’t forget the electrical system! A thorough electrical checkup can uncover potential issues that could frighten buyers or even trigger costly repairs afterward . Here's a vital checklist to guarantee your electrical system Ocala home electrical inspection checklist is up-to-code and appealing to potential buyers. First , have a qualified electrician evaluate the electrical panel, looking for proper labeling and enough capacity. Next , examine all outlets for proper operation and grounding . Don't forgetting to verify smoke and carbon monoxide sensors are working correctly, and replace any worn ones if needed. Finally, ensure all illumination devices are properly affixed and in good condition. Finishing this checklist can substantially improve your property's marketability and potentially increase its worth.
